How do you calculate the orbital speed of Jupiter?
Jupiter’s distance from the Sun is 5.2 A.U., or 7.8×1011 meters and the Sun’s mass is 2×1030 kilograms. The orbital speed of Jupiter around the Sun is Sqrt[6.7×10-11 × (2×1030)/(7.8×1011)] = Sqrt[1.718×108] = 1.3×104 meters/second, or 13 kilometers/second.

What is the equation for orbital radius?
The orbital speed can be found using v = SQRT(G*M/R). The R value (radius of orbit) is the earth’s radius plus the height above the earth – in this case, 6.59 x 10 ^6 m. If we assume the orbit is circular, the equation can easily be derived by equating the gravitational force with the centripetal force.

What is the orbital speed of Jupiter?
Orbital parameters
| Jupiter | Ratio (Jupiter/Earth) | |
|---|---|---|
| Aphelion (106 km) | 816.618 | 5.369 |
| Synodic period (days) | 398.88 | – |
| Mean orbital velocity (km/s) | 13.06 | 0.439 |
| Max. orbital velocity (km/s) | 13.72 | 0.453 |

What is the density of Uranus?
1.27 g/cm³
Uranus/Density
The density of Uranus is 1.27 grams per cubic centimeter, making it the second least dense planet in the solar system.
